概括
气候变化影响医疗保健,增加病. 透析治疗对医疗保健的碳足迹做出了重大贡献,需要可持续的环境保护实践.

背景情况:
- 气候变化对全球健康构成重大风险,包括病诊断的增加.
- 医疗保健系统,特别是透析,由于资源消耗和浪费,对环境产生重大影响.
- 越来越需要解决医疗治疗的生态足迹问题.
结论:
- 透析通过水,能源和废物为医疗保健部门的碳足迹做出了贡献.
- 在透析中实施可持续实践对于减轻其对环境的影响至关重要.
- 需要进一步的研究和系统变化,以促进环保透析在全球范围内.

Hemodialysis I: Introduction
36
Hemodialysis (HD) is a medical treatment that artificially removes waste products, excess fluids, and toxins from the blood when the kidneys are no longer able to perform these functions effectively. In this process, blood is filtered through a semipermeable membrane, allowing for the selective removal of waste while preserving necessary components like blood cells and proteins.
